Valletta took a giant step towards the Premier League crown this afternoon by beating Marsaxlokk 2-1 at Ta'Qali, thus consolidating their position at the top of the league table.

Marsaxlokk's Pullicino opened the score just before the hour but Giglio made it 1-1 just under 15 minutes later and the ever-green Monesterolo gave Valletta the precious winner from an 84th minute penalty.

Marsxlokk could have salvaged a point but lost a last minute penalty.

Earlier, Hiberians beat Mqabba 4-2 to make sure they stay in the premier division next year.

Xuereb and Xerri scored from the spot for Hibs in the first half but Pereira and Briffa scored for Mqabba to even things. Xuereb and Xerri scored again in the second half to give the Paolites a deserved win.
